Aluminum roof installation involves replacing or installing a new roof made primarily from aluminum panels or sheets. This process typically includes preparing the existing roof surface, measuring and cutting the aluminum materials to fit the property's dimensions, and securely attaching the panels to ensure durability and weather resistance. Aluminum roofing is valued for its lightweight nature, resistance to rust, and long-lasting performance, making it a practical choice for many homeowners seeking a reliable roofing solution.
This service helps address common roofing problems such as corrosion, leaks, and structural deterioration. Aluminum roofs are especially effective in areas prone to moisture or heavy rainfall, as they resist rust and corrosion better than traditional materials like steel or asphalt shingles. Additionally, aluminum’s reflective qualities can help reduce heat transfer, potentially lowering cooling costs during warmer months. The overview below groups typical Aluminum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or aluminum roof repairs, such as patching leaks or replacing small sections,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, though prices can vary based on the extent of the work and local rates.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of an aluminum roof or addressing specific problem areas gener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this middle tier.
Full Roof Replacement - A complete aluminum roof installation for an average-sized home often costs between $5,000 and $12,000. While many full replacements fall into this range, larger or more intricate projects can exceed $15,000.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ive or highly customized aluminum roofing projects can reach $20,000 and above. These higher-end jobs are less common and typically involve complex design features or larger structures.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
